In various industries and daily - life applications, the use of ceramic - lined products has been on the rise. From industrial pipes to medical implants, ceramic linings offer unique advantages such as high abrasion resistance, Resistenza alla corrosione, and heat resistance. Tuttavia, a common question that arises is: is ceramic - lined safe? Let's delve into this topic from multiple aspects.
Materiale - Related Safety
Chemical Composition of Ceramic Linings
Ceramics used for lining purposes are typically composed of inorganic, non - Materiali metallici. Per esempio, in traditional ceramic manufacturing, clay minerals like kaolinite (Al₂Si₂O₅(OH)₄) are fundamental. In modern advanced ceramics, substances such as alumina (Al₂O₃), carburo di silicio (SiC), and zirconia (ZrO₂) sono ampiamente utilizzati. These materials are generally chemically stable. Ceramics are highly resistant to chemical reactions. They do not easily react with acids, alcali, or most solvents. In applicazioni industriali, this means that ceramic - lined pipes used to transport corrosive chemicals pose little risk of the ceramic lining leaching harmful substances into the transported material due to chemical degradation.
Potential Hazardous Substances in Ceramic Linings
While most ceramic lining materials are safe, there are some considerations. In the production of ceramic products, especially those with decorative elements, pigments may be used. To enhance the performance of these pigments during the firing process, heavy metals like lead may be added. In ceramic - lined tableware or containers meant for food or beverage storage, if the inner surface has colored patterns or designs and the pigments are not properly applied (Per esempio, if they are on the surface of the glaze rather than being under it), there is a risk of heavy metal leaching into the contents. Tuttavia, when proper manufacturing standards are followed, such as using lead - free pigments or ensuring that decorative elements are applied in a way that they do not come into contact with the product's contents, this risk can be minimized.
Safety in Different Applications
Applicazioni industriali
Pipes and Vessels
In industries such as mining, generazione di energia, e lavorazione chimica, ceramica - lined pipes and vessels are commonly used. Nel mining, ceramica - lined pipes transport abrasive materials like sand, gravel, and mineral slurries. The high abrasion resistance of ceramic linings ensures that the pipes do not wear out quickly, preventing leaks and potential environmental hazards. In chemical plants, ceramica - lined reactors and storage tanks are used to contain highly corrosive substances. The chemical resistance of the ceramic lining safeguards the integrity of the vessel, preventing leaks that could release dangerous chemicals into the environment. The safety of ceramic - lined industrial equipment is also related to its structural integrity. BENE - installed ceramic linings can withstand high pressures and temperatures, reducing the risk of equipment failure.
Machinery Components
In machinery like ball mills in the mining and cement industries, ceramic linings are used to protect the interior walls. The ceramic lining not only extends the lifespan of the equipment but also ensures that no harmful particles are released into the material being processed. This is crucial as any contamination from worn - out metal components could affect the quality of the final product.
Applicazioni mediche
Implants
Ceramic materials are increasingly used in medical implants, come i sostituti dell'anca e del ginocchio. Ceramica - lined implants offer several safety advantages. They are biocompatible, which means they are well - tolerated by the body's tissues. Unlike some metal implants, ceramic implants do not release metal ions into the body, reducing the risk of allergic reactions or adverse effects on organs. The high hardness and wear - resistance of ceramic linings in implants ensure long - term stability and functionality. Tuttavia, there are some concerns. In rare cases, ceramic implants can fracture, which may require additional surgeries. But advancements in ceramic materials and implant design are continuously reducing this risk.
Consumer Product Applications
Tableware and Containers
For ceramic - lined tableware and food containers, safety is a top concern. Come accennato in precedenza, if the ceramic lining is free of decorative elements on the inner surface or has properly applied (under - glaze) decorations, it is generally safe for food contact. Tuttavia, consumers should avoid using ceramic - lined products that show signs of damage, such as cracks or chips, as this could increase the risk of harmful substance release. In the case of ceramic - lined cookware, the ceramic lining can provide a non - stick surface without the use of potentially harmful chemicals like perfluorooctanoic acid (PFOA) found in some non - stick coatings.

FAQ
- What should I look for to ensure the safety of ceramic - lined tableware?
- Check if the inner surface is free of decorative patterns or, if there are patterns, ensure they are under the glaze. Avoid tableware with surface - level decorations as they may contain heavy metals that can leach into food. Anche, look for signs of damage such as cracks or chips, as damaged ceramic - lined tableware can pose a safety risk.
- Are ceramic - lined medical implants completely risk - free?
- While ceramic - lined medical implants offer many safety advantages like biocompatibility and low wear - valutare, they are not completely risk - free. In rare cases, ceramic implants can fracture. Tuttavia, the risk of this happening has been significantly reduced with advancements in material science and implant design. It's important for patients to discuss the potential risks and benefits with their doctors before undergoing an implant procedure.
- Can ceramic - lined industrial equipment pose environmental risks?
- If properly maintained and designed, ceramica - lined industrial equipment generally does not pose environmental risks. The high abrasion and corrosion resistance of ceramic linings prevent leaks of harmful substances. Tuttavia, if the equipment is damaged or not installed correctly, it could potentially release hazardous materials into the environment. Regular inspections and proper maintenance of ceramic - lined industrial equipment are essential to minimize such risks.
